Rollover crash sends New Holstein teens to hospital
The driver of a sports utility vehicle blamed a faulty suspension spring for a rollover crash that ended up sending him and his passenger to the hospital last week. The accident occurred on April 22nd at 2:35 p.m. on State Highway 57 in the Town of Brussels as the 18-year-old New Holstein man was traveling north. According to the accident report, the driver noticed shaking in his car before a suspension spring near his left rear tire broke, causing him to veer into the left lane. When he re-entered the right lane, he was pulled into the ditch where his vehicle rolled over. The driver and his 14-year-old passenger suffered minor injuries and were transported to Door County Medical Center for further medical treatment. The car was towed away, and no citations were issued.
